The Orchid Initiative draws inspiration from the fascinating world of orchids to illustrate our mission and approach.
Unlike other plant seeds, orchid seeds lack the nutrients to grow on their own. The gorgeous blooms you see come from one-in-a-million lucky matches with specific symbiotic partners.
Like orchid seeds, promising ideas start small and can lack crucial connections and resources necessary for them to take off and thrive.
At the Orchid Initiative, we nurture mutually beneficial collaborations by connecting our members to meaningful projects otherwise limited by conventional means.
